Output 71c8b2fd1a1e206b168868991b47ff57292fcfe303eb1585cc21d4aa5fb10993:7

value
18085568
script pubkey
OP_0 OP_PUSHBYTES_20 8d8aa91fd702c6c8871ef234387fbbfde628bc98
address
bc1q3k92j87hqtrv3pc77g6rslamlhnz30ycrrzzuu
transaction
71c8b2fd1a1e206b168868991b47ff57292fcfe303eb1585cc21d4aa5fb10993
spent
true